Artist Bio

Drew Knight is a singer/songwriter/multi-instrumentalist. His music fuses Synthwave/Retrowave with elements of modern pop. An emerging artist, Drew is one to watch. Between his adept songwriting skills and his crisp, soulful voice, Drew is today’s answer to the powerful pop duo Hall and Oates all in one man. From his unique wave take on Ne-Yo’s “So Sick” to the experimental jams he shared on his Instagram account during the #songcreationchallenge of 2022, it’s clear that Drew both knows his musical roots just as well as he knows how to blaze new trails for us to explore.

Drew is based in sunny Tampa, FL. He takes inspiration from 80s New Wave, 90s R&B, and Synthwave.

 
 

“Keep Moving” – Single with Drew Knight and Star Madman

Drew’s first single “Keep Moving” was released in 2021 and features fellow artist Star Madman on vocals (@starmadman). These two offer up a duet of energies in perfect complement to each other.

 

What influences your music?

“My influence is kind of all over the place. I grew up listening to New Wave and Post Punk, but also have some roots in Post-Hardcore and Punk. I actually played guitar in multiple punk, shoegaze and post-hardcore & metal bands through the late 90s, early 00s.”

 

What challenges have you faced as an Artist?

“This is actually my first venture as a solo artist and lead vocalist. I have written music and been singing for years, but this is the first time I’ve attempted to do it all myself. I think one of my biggest struggles is figuring out where I fit in genre-wise, because my musical taste is a bit eclectic and changes so frequently.”

 

What are your future goals with your music?

“Releasing my first EP as a solo artist later this year.”

 

Tell us about your studio setup.

“I am a microphone junkie! My 2 favorites would be my U47 clone and my Neumann TLM 103.”

 

What projects are you working on now?

“Currently writing for the EP. I am actually working with Bradley Denniston from Radium Media on this upcoming release and making plans to head out to LA later this Summer.”
